Handover: Evensail schema registry, from Marek to Dovra. Plugin authors hit the registry for event schema validation; compatibility mode is transitive-backward, no exceptions. Rejected schemas return a diff, not just an error code — keep that behavior, plugins depend on it. The Quillport mirror lags by up to five minutes; don't point CI at it. Deprecation notices go out via the changelog feed, two releases ahead. Everything else you need is in the plugin author guide. Current service configuration values follow below.

config for kafof-bawef:
holath:
  log_level: debug
  metrics_host: metrics.holath.qorvelsys.internal
  pin: 2191
  pool_size: 32

Title: Wiki role checks bypassed via page-move in Thornvale Wiki

Moving a page from a restricted space to a public one carries the content but drops the restricted-space ACL, so viewer-role users gain read access without review. Expected behavior: the move should require editor rights in both spaces and re-evaluate inherited permissions. Reproduced on staging with a viewer account. The affected build is identified by the token below.

trace token, kawip-fafog: htk14_26e64c4d35154e

Changelog — Bramblehook registry v2.3: the setting formerly called REGISTRY_COMPAT_STRICT has been renamed to SCHEMA_GUARD_MODE to match the naming convention adopted after the Larkspur migration. The old name still works but logs a deprecation warning and will be removed in v2.5. Accepted values are unchanged: strict, lenient, and off. Update your deploy manifests before the next weekly cut so the sync dashboard stops flagging drift. While editing the env file, note that the registry's client credential belongs directly below this entry.

sealed setting: ARCHIVE_KEY3=8d0